Index. 520 The "Sunningdale experiment" of 1973-4 witnessed the first attempt to establish peace in Northern Ireland through power-sharing. However, its provisions, particularly the cross-border 'Council of Ireland', proved to be a step too far. The experiment floundered amid ongoing paramilitary- led violence, finally collapsing in May 1974 as a result of the Ulster Workers' Council strike.
